Anne Moubray FORREST was born on 22nd March 1855 in Stirling[1]. She was the sixth child of William Hutton FORREST and Margaret Thompson STEPHENSON.
Around 1890, she moved with sisters Margaret and Jane to live in "Whinfield", St Margaret's Drive, Dunblane.
She died, unmarried, on 22nd February 1928 at Whinfield[2].
